2014 XPF to UYU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the XPF to UYU ex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 6, valuing the pair at 0.2683.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 8, dropping to 0.2403.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0280 UYU.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.2434 to the December average rate of 0.2479,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.87%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 0.2683 was up 7.35% compared to the 2013 peak of 0.2499,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.2505 0.2403 0.2434
February 0.2594 0.2449 0.2544
March 0.2650 0.2572 0.2603
April 0.2666 0.2616 0.2641
May 0.2683 0.2622 0.2646
June 0.2629 0.2601 0.2614
July 0.2620 0.2581 0.2602
August 0.2669 0.2608 0.2644
September 0.2644 0.2604 0.2625
October 0.2613 0.2535 0.2588
November 0.2549 0.2455 0.2509
December 0.2545 0.2453 0.2479
